I am acquiring these Shares for investment for my own account only and not with a view to, or for resale in connection with, a “distribution” thereof within the meaning of the Securities Act of 1933, as amended (the “Securities Act”).  I understand that the Shares are subject to the terms (including transfer restrictions) set forth in that certain Eighth Amended and Restated Voting Agreement among the Company and its stockholders dated November 21, 2019, as may be amended from time to time, and in that certain Eighth Amended and Restated Right of First Refusal and Co-Sale Agreement among the Company and its stockholders dated November 21, 2019, as may be amended from time to time.

 

I acknowledge and understand that the Shares constitute “restricted securities” under the Securities Act and have not been registered under the Securities Act in reliance upon a specific exemption therefrom, which exemption depends upon, among other things, the bona fide nature of my investment intent as expressed herein.  In this connection, I understand that, in the view of the Securities and Exchange Commission, the statutory basis for such exemption may be unavailable if my representation was predicated solely upon a present intention to hold these Shares for the minimum capital gains period specified under tax statutes, for a deferred sale, for or until an increase or decrease in the market price of the Shares, or for a period of one year or any other fixed period in the future.  I further understand that the Shares must be held indefinitely unless they are subsequently registered under the Securities Act or an exemption from such registration is available.  I further acknowledge and understand that the Company is under no obligation to register the Shares.  I understand that the certificate evidencing the Shares will be imprinted with a legend which prohibits the transfer of the Shares unless they are registered or such registration is not required in the opinion of counsel satisfactory to the Company and other legends required under the applicable state or federal securities laws.


 

 

I am familiar with the provisions of Rule 144, promulgated under the Securities Act, which, in substance, permit limited public resale of “restricted securities” acquired, directly or indirectly from the issuer thereof, in a non-public offering subject to the satisfaction of certain conditions.    

 

In the event that the Company does not become subject to the requirements of Section 13 or 15(d) of the Exchange Act, then the Securities may be resold in certain limited circumstances subject to the provisions of Rule 144, which requires the resale to occur not less than one year after the later of the date the Securities were sold by the Company or the date the Securities were sold by an affiliate of the Company, within the meaning of Rule 144; and, in the case of acquisition of the Securities by an affiliate only, the satisfaction of the following conditions: (1) the resale being made through a broker in an unsolicited “broker’s transaction,” in transactions directly with a market maker (as said term is defined under the Exchange Act) or in “riskless principal transactions” (as said term is defined in the Note to Rule 144(f)(1)); (2) the amount of Securities being sold during any three month period not exceeding the limitations specified in Rule 144(e); (3) the availability of certain public information about the Company; and (4) the timely filing of a Form 144, if applicable.

 

I further understand that in the event all of the applicable requirements of Rule 144 are not satisfied, registration under the Securities Act, compliance with Regulation A under the Securities Act, or some other registration exemption will be required; and that, notwithstanding the fact that Rules 144 is not exclusive, the Sta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ission has expressed its opinion that a person proposing to sell private placement securities other than in a registered offering and otherwise than pursuant to Rule 144 will have a substantial burden of proof in establishing that an exemption from registration is available for such offers or sales, and that such persons and their respective brokers who participate in such transactions do so at their own risk.  I understand that no assurances can be given that any such other registration exemption will be available in such event.

PROXY

 

The undersigned, as record holder of securities of Vroom, Inc. (the "Company"), hereby irrevocably appoints the Chairman of the Board of Directors or the Chief Executive Officer of the Company from time to time as my proxy to attend and to receive notices of all meetings of the stockholders of the Company, including without limitation any class meetings, and to vote, execute consents, including without limitation class consents and written consents, and otherwise represent me with respect to all shares of Common Stock of the Company issued to me upon exercise of options granted to me pursuant to the Vroom, Inc. Second Amended and Restated 2014 Equity Incentive Plan, as amended, and all securities of the Company which may be issued to the undersigned in respect of such shares of Common Stock, including without limitation by way of conversion, stock-split, stock dividends, reverse stock split, stock reclassification and other recapitalization events (collectively, "Shares") in the same manner and with the same effect as if the undersigned were personally present at any such meeting or voting such Shares or personally acting on any matters submitted to stockholders for approval or consent.

 

This proxy is made pursuant to the Vroom, Inc. Second Amended and Restated 2014 Equity Incentive Plan, as amended.

 

The Shares shall be voted by the proxy holder in the same proportion as the votes of the other stockholders of the Company.

 

This proxy is irrevocable as it may effect rights of third parties and is coupled with an interest.

 

The irrevocable proxy will remain in full force and effect until the consummation of the Company’s Initial Public Offering, upon which it will terminate automatically.

 

This proxy shall be signed exactly as the stockholder’s name appears on his stock certificate. Joint stockholders must each sign this proxy. If signed by an attorney in fact, the Power of Attorney must be attached.
